Short answer baking salmon with skin on:
Baking salmon with the skin intact locks in moisture and flavor. Preheat oven to 400°F, season fish fillets and place them skin-side down on a parchment paper-lined sheet pan.Tuck any thin edges under to prevent overcooking. Bake for about 12-15 minutes or until the internal temperature reaches at least 145°F when tested with an instant-read thermometer inserted into the thickest part of the flesh without touching bone.

Q: Should I leave the skin on?
A: Yes! There are several reasons why leaving the skins intact while cooking makes sense—it keeps moisture in during cooking, provides a crispy texture once cooked and contains a lot of nutrients like omega-3s.

Q: How long does it take for the salmon to bake?
A: Timing that perfect golden brown, moist and flaky piece of Salmon with skin can become challenging if overcooked.Generally 12-15 minutes is ideal but also depends on thickness ,type fish as well as your oven set up.Nevertheless we strongly suggest investing in an instant-read thermometer since this method takes risk out giving only best cooked meats .Recommendable temperature reading should be within range ( @145 F)for adequate protein distribution avoiding infections.

The Benefits of Cooking Your Fish With the Skin Intact
Cooking fish with the skin intact may seem like a daunting task for some. However, it’s actually quite simple and more importantly significantly beneficial – both nutritionally and in terms of taste.
The first benefit of cooking your fish with the skin on is that it helps retain moisture during cooking. This ensures that you end up having tender, juicy flesh when cooked instead of dry meat which can be hard to enjoy.
